From 12a3e1ada06c702c403cf1eebb063ef7a34688cd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Dzmitry Sankouski Date: Tue, 22 Feb 2022 21:49:52 +0300 Subject: arm: init: save previous bootloader data When u-boot is used as a chain-loaded bootloader (replacing OS kernel), previous bootloader leaves data in RAM, that can be reused. For example, on recent arm linux system, when chainloading u-boot, there are initramfs and fdt in RAM prepared for OS booting. Initramfs may be modified to store u-boot's payload, thus providing the ability to use chainloaded u-boot to boot OS without any storage support.
